Chicken Rice Recipe

This chicken rice recipe is baked in the oven.

Cook Time: 40 minutes

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up long-grain rice, uncooked
  • 1 cup sliced celery
  • 1 (10oz) package frozen peas, about 1 1/2 cups
  • 2 cups water
  • 2 teaspoons salt
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1 to 1 1/2 cups cooked diced chicken
  • 2 tablespoons flour
  • 1/8 teaspoon pepper
  • 2/3 cup evaporated milk
  • 1 cup shredded mild Cheddar or American cheese

Preparation:

In a medium saucepan, combine rice, celery, water and 1 teaspoon salt. Heat to boiling. Cover and simmer for about 8 minutes; add peas and cook an additional 8 to 10 minutes, or until rice is tender and water is absorbed.

Melt butter in a medium saucepan or skillet. Saute chicken for about 1 minute; stir in flour, pepper, and remaining 1 teaspoon salt. Continue to cook, stirring constantly, just until bubbling. Stir in milk and 1 1/3 cups water. Continue cooking and stirring until sauce thickens and gently boils for about 1 minute. Pour sauce over the chicken rice mixture; transfer to shallow buttered 2-quart baking dish. Sprinkle with cheese; bake chicken rice recipe at 375° for 20 minutes.
Chicken rice bake serves 4.
